I'm not sort if this is the right place for it but when painting the gearbox would I need a high temperture paint like you would use on calipers and cam covers or would a tin of hammerite be alright

Best to clean it thoroughly, etch primer and then spray high temp paint for a better finish. Hammerite will probably chip off quite easily.

Did mine in this way when it was out of the car and the finish is holding up well  :smiley:
